#0e2c51 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0e2c51 is composed of 5.5% red, 17.3% green and 31.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 82.7% cyan, 45.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 68.2% black. It has a hue angle of 213.1 degrees, a saturation of 70.5% and a lightness of 18.6%. #0e2c51 color hex could be obtained by blending #1c58a2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003366.

#0e2c51 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0e2c51 has RGB values of R:14, G:44, B:81 and CMYK values of C:0.83, M:0.46, Y:0, K:0.68. Its decimal value is 928849.

Shades and Tints of #0e2c51
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02080e is the darkest color, while #fcfdff is the lightest one.

Tones of #0e2c51
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#2f2f30 is the less saturated color, while #032b5c is the most saturated one.
